Transaction 57c3ff33c105d1a6c16fc8fd3cba8bcee47e370ce37bef3d18413ae57e80184f

1 Input
2 Outputs
  • 57c3ff33c105d1a6c16fc8fd3cba8bcee47e370ce37bef3d18413ae57e80184f:0
  • value  998686
    address  1MmRCBJshJEVQE4egJKHEDZiNAUYNdzjyX
  • 57c3ff33c105d1a6c16fc8fd3cba8bcee47e370ce37bef3d18413ae57e80184f:1
  • value  7359864
    address  1HoHoqXv8EDVjnVinG17xEM7sZ29BxTyXb